-1

我了解 zxing 并且知道如何将其用作 jar,因此我不必使用意图方法。但...:

  1. Sean Owen,zxing 背后的开发者,显然并不喜欢人们将它嵌入到他们的应用程序中,而是希望他们使用 Intent apporach,这在我看来真的会扼杀用户体验。
  2. 我只需要编码部分。粗鲁地说:我想为 QR 码更改一些数据。无需扫描、解码等。
  3. 它几乎使我的应用程序的大小增加了一倍,但这是最不重要的问题。

我用谷歌搜索了很长时间,但 zxing 似乎是迄今为止最受欢迎的解决方案,因为我没有发现其他任何东西。您是否知道其他一些库或只是一些准备使用的算法?我不想重新发明轮子...

4

2 回答 2

2

您可以使用此处提供的库: http ://www.swetake.com/qr/index-e.html 最后一个链接会将您带到一个日本站点,您可以在其中下载 Java 库。它很旧,但它有效。

于 2012-04-09T16:29:31.933 回答
1

如果您总是有互联网,一个选项是使用 Google 的 API 生成 QR 码。 http://createqrcode.appspot.com/

示例(返回 png 图像):http ://chart.apis.google.com/chart?cht=qr&chs=300x300&chl=MESSAGE&chld=H|0

于 2012-04-09T16:22:08.990 回答